    PDF Printer no longer working

    Running Alpha5V12 and I am getting the following message when trying to print preview a PDF.
    Alpha five was not able to install the pdf printer. it is possible that you do not have the necessary permission to install printer drivers.
    please log on to this computer with administrator privileges.

    I am logged on as a user with administrative rights, and also, this used to work before. I believe it worked prior to my upgrade from Windows8 to Windows10. I have tried removing the Alpha5 Printer (actually I was previously just getting an error with the preview, so I removed to printer to try and reinstall it).
    I also performed the Amyumi directory reinstall as was mentioned in another post.

                            #14
                            Re: PDF Printer no longer working

                            what I did to get it working was to first delete all alpha-amyuny printer drivers from the windows 'devices and printers' screen
                            then I installed Alpha and patch from scratch - fixed the issue

                              #15
                              Re: PDF Printer no longer working

                              After additional research, we've found that the amyuni driver doesn't appear to be the primary problem in our case. It works fine to create .pdfs for email or fax but not for printing. It seems that it switches to the amyuni printer as the default printer then gets stuck on amyuni so when the script continues to physically print, it tries to basically print to itself. It doesn't happen on computers that are still Win 8. It doesn't happen on one that was upgraded from Win 7 to 10. It does happen on at least one that upgraded from Win 8 to Win 10 and a couple more that we can't remember if were originally Win 8 or Win 10. One option I'm looking at is to modify the script so it prompts for the printer but I'd rather find a solution that allows it to run as intended. It is Alpha V11 BTW.
